Delight in these soft and chewy Santa's Cookies featuring double chocolate chips and festive red and green M&M candies. Made with a unique twist of instant vanilla pudding mix, these holiday treats are perfectly sweet and loaded with chocolate goodness, ideal for festive celebrations or cozy winter days.
Ingredients

Wet Ingredients
- ¾ cup butter (softened)
- ¾ cup brown sugar
- ¼ cup s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 egg
Dry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 small box instant vanilla pudding mix (dry, 3.4 ounce box)
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on salt
Add-ins
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 1 cup white chocolate chips
- 1 cup red and green M&M candies
Instructions
- Cream Butter and Sugars: In a large bowl, cream the softened butter, brown sugar, and sugar together for 1-2 minutes until the mixture is fluffy and smooth.
- Add Vanilla and Egg: Mix in the vanilla extract and egg thoroughly until all ingredients are well combined.
- Mix Dry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, instant vanilla pudding mix, baking soda, and salt until evenly distributed.
- Combine Wet and Dry: Gradually add the dry ingredient mixture into the wet ingredients, stirring until just incorporated. Then fold in most of the semi-sweet chocolate chips, reserving some for decoration.
- Chill Dough: Cover the dough and refrigerate it for at least one hour to help it firm up and develop flavors.
- Prepare Baking Sheet: Pre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Lightly grease a baking sheet by misting with cooking spray and wiping it off with a paper towel for a subtle non-stick surface.
- Shape Cookies: Roll approximately 3 tablespoons of chilled cookie dough into golf ball-sized balls. Place them spaced on the prepared baking sheet.
- Add Toppings: Gently press the reserved chocolate chips and M&M candies onto the tops of the cookie dough balls to ensure they remain visible after baking.
- Bake: Bake the cookies for 12 minutes or until they are set but still slightly underdone to maintain softness.
- Cool Cookies: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for at least 10 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to finish cooling completely.
- Store: Once cooled, store the cookies in an airtight container at room temperature to keep them fresh.
Notes
- For best results, use instant vanilla pudding mix—not cook-and-serve pudding.
- Chilling the dough is crucial to prevent spreading and to enhance the texture and flavor.
- If you prefer softer cookies, do not overbake them; slight underbaking helps retain chewiness.
- Lightly greasing and wiping the baking sheet helps cookies lift easily without sticking.
- Feel free to substitute M&Ms with other festive candies or chocolate pieces for variation.
